What is bioengineering?

Bioengineering is an interdisciplinary field that applies principles of biology, engineering, and medicine to develop technologies and devices that improve healthcare and advance biological research. Bioengineers may work on projects such as designing medical devices, developing artificial organs, creating tissue engineering solutions, or improving drug delivery systems. The field blends knowledge from various scientific disciplines to solve complex problems in health and medicine, agriculture, and environmental systems. Bioengineers often collaborate with doctors, researchers, and other engineers to create innovative solutions that benefit society.

What is the difference between Bioengineering vs Biomedical Engineering?

AspectBioengineeringBiomedical Engineering
Required CredentialsBachelor's or Master's in Bioengineering or related fieldsBachelor's or Master's in Biomedical Engineering or related fields
Work EnvironmentResearch labs, healthcare companies, biotech firmsHospitals, medical device companies, research institutions
Industry UsageDevelops biological solutions, tissue engineering, genetic researchDesigns medical devices, prosthetics, and healthcare technology

Bioengineering and Biomedical Engineering share many credentials and work environments, often overlapping in research and development roles. However, bioengineering tends to focus more on biological systems and genetic research, while biomedical engineering emphasizes medical devices and healthcare technology. Both fields are integral to advancing healthcare and often collaborate within the biotech and medical industries.

Keck Graduate Institute (KGI) was founded in 1997 as the first higher education institution in the United States dedicated exclusively to education and research related to the applied life sciences. KGI offers innovative postgraduate degrees and certificates that integrate life and health sciences, business, pharmacy, engineering, and genetics, focusing on industry projects, hands-on industry experiences, and team collaborations. KGI employs an entrepreneurial approach and industry connections that allow students to become leaders in healthcare and the applied life sciences.
Located in beautiful Claremont, California, KGI is a member of the Claremont Colleges, a consortium of five undergraduate liberal arts colleges, two graduate institutions, and The Claremont Colleges Services, which provides shared institutional support services. Each nationally recognized college has its own campus, students and faculty, and distinctive mission, and each offers top-notch curricula, small classes, distinguished professors, and personalized instruction. The Claremont Colleges consistently place at the top of national college rankings, including Forbes, Money and U.S. News and World Report, and the Princeton Review.
